    What Is an Iron Removal Filter System?

    An iron removal filter system is a point-of-entry treatment designed to eliminate iron from your entire home’s water supply. It’s installed where the water line enters your house—usually in the basement, garage, or a utility closet. Unlike a simple sediment filter that just catches particles, these systems chemically change dissolved iron so it can be trapped and flushed away.

    They’re a must-have for well water. City water is usually treated, but if you’re on a private well, iron is your problem to solve. The goal isn’t just better-tasting water (though you’ll get that). It’s protecting your water heater, washing machine, dishwasher, and every pipe and fixture from the slow, destructive buildup that iron causes.

    How Iron Removal Systems Work

    The process depends on the technology, but they all follow the same basic principle: oxidize, filter, and backwash. Here’s the breakdown.

    Step 1: Oxidation

    First, the system converts invisible, dissolved ferrous iron (Fe²⁺) into visible, solid ferric iron (Fe³⁺). This is the magic step. Different systems use different methods to trigger this reaction. Some inject air (oxygen is a powerful oxidizer), others use a chemical like potassium permanganate, and some rely on a catalytic media bed that speeds up the reaction naturally.

    Step 2: Filtration

    Once the iron is a solid, it’s physically trapped inside the filter tank. The media bed acts like a super-fine net. This is where the quality of the filter cartridge or media matters immensely. A good bed will have a high surface area and the right grain size to catch particles without clogging too quickly.

    Step 3: Backwashing

    This is the self-cleaning cycle. Every few days, the system automatically reverses water flow, flushing the trapped iron particles down the drain. It’s loud—sounds like a rushing waterfall for 10-20 minutes—but it’s vital. Without regular backwashing, the media bed would cement over and stop working. The frequency and intensity of backwash are key specs to compare.

    Key Benefits of Installing One

    No More Stains. This is the number one reason people call us. An iron filter eliminates those stubborn rust stains in your sinks, tubs, and toilets. Your laundry comes out bright, not dingy and orange.

    Better Taste and Odor. High iron often comes with a metallic taste and that rotten-egg smell (hydrogen sulfide). A good system, especially one with activated carbon, removes both. Your water will taste like water again.

    Protect Your Appliances. Iron scale builds up in water heaters, cutting efficiency and lifespan. It clogs the tiny valves in dishwashers and washing machines. An iron filter is preventative maintenance that saves you thousands in early replacements.

    Clearer Water. If your water runs clear but turns orange when it sits, you have ferrous iron. If it comes out of the tap already rusty, you have ferric iron. A proper system handles both, giving you crystal-clear water from every tap.

    Potential Drawbacks to Consider

    They Need Space and a Drain. These are big tanks, often over 50 inches tall. You also need a nearby floor drain for the backwash cycle. Not every utility closet is set up for this.

    Upfront Cost is Real. A whole-house system isn’t cheap. You’re looking at $800 to $2500 installed for a quality unit. The cheap, big-box store models often fail within two years in our experience.

    Maintenance Isn’t Zero. Beyond backwashing, you’ll need to check the air injector (if equipped), add chemicals like potassium permanganate to some systems every few months, and eventually replace the media bed (every 5-10 years). It’s not “set and forget.”

    Types of Iron Filter Systems

    Air Injection Oxidation (AIO)

    This is our favorite for most homeowners. It uses a pocket of air at the top of the tank to oxidize iron. No chemicals needed. The air pocket is automatically replenished during the backwash cycle. It’s effective, low-maintenance, and handles moderate iron levels (up to 10-15 ppm) very well.

    Birm Media Filters

    Birm is a lightweight, granular media that acts as a catalyst for the oxidation reaction. It requires dissolved oxygen in the water to work, so it’s often paired with an aeration system. It’s cheaper than AIO but can foul easily if your water has manganese or oil. A solid budget option for low-to-mid iron levels.

    KDF & Catalytic Carbon Filters

    These use a combination of KDF (a copper-zinc alloy) and catalytic carbon. The KDF handles oxidation, while the carbon removes taste, odor, and chlorine. The whole house carbon filtration aspect is a big plus. We often recommend these for iron combined with other contaminants.

    Chemical Oxidation (Chlorination or Permanganate)

    The heavy artillery. For very high iron (over 15 ppm) or iron bacteria, you inject a chemical oxidant (usually chlorine or potassium permanganate) into a retention tank, then filter it out. It’s the most powerful and reliable method, but it involves handling chemicals and has higher ongoing costs.

    Buying Guide: What Actually Matters

    Get Your Water Tested First. Don’t guess. You need to know your iron concentration (in ppm), the pH of your water, and if you have manganese or sulfur. A $20 test kit from a lab is the best investment you’ll make.

    Match the System to Your Iron Type. Ferric iron (solid) needs good sediment filtration. Ferrous iron (dissolved) needs oxidation. Most well water has a mix. An AIO system is the best all-rounder.

    Flow Rate is Critical. This is measured in gallons per minute (GPM). If the system can’t keep up with your peak demand (say, two showers and the dishwasher running), your water pressure will plummet. Calculate your home’s peak GPM and add a 20% buffer.

    Look for NSF/ANSI Certification. Specifically, look for NSF/ANSI Standard 42 (aesthetic effects—taste, odor) and Standard 61 (drinking water system components). This is your assurance the materials are safe and the claims are verified. Don’t trust unverified “lab tested” claims.

    Frequently Asked Questions

    What is the best way to remove iron from well water?
    For most homes, an Air Injection Oxidation (AIO) system is the best balance of effectiveness and low maintenance. It oxidizes dissolved iron without chemicals and flushes it away automatically. For very high levels (>10 ppm), a chemical injection system might be necessary.
    Can I use a water softener to remove iron?
    Water softeners can remove small amounts of clear-water iron (ferrous iron, typically under 2-3 ppm). But it’s hard on the resin bed and can foul it quickly. A dedicated iron filter is always a better, more reliable solution. We don’t recommend using a softener as your primary iron treatment.
    How do I know what type of iron I have?
    Fill a clear glass with water straight from the tap. If it’s clear but turns orange/brown after sitting for 30 minutes, you have dissolved (ferrous) iron. If it comes out of the tap already discolored, you have oxidized (ferric) iron or iron sediment. Most well water has a mix.
    How often do iron filters need maintenance?
    Most systems automatically backwash every 2-3 days. Beyond that, check the air injector (if equipped) annually. The media bed itself lasts 5-10 years before needing replacement. Chemical systems require refilling the chemical tank every 1-3 months.
    Do iron filters waste a lot of water?
    Yes, the backwash cycle uses water—typically 50-150 gallons per cycle. If you’re on a septic system, this can be a concern. Look for systems with adjustable backwash frequency and duration to minimize waste. It’s a necessary trade-off for clean water.
    Can I install an iron filter myself?
    If you’re handy with plumbing, yes. It involves cutting into your main water line, installing bypass valves, and connecting the drain line. But if you’re not confident, hire a pro. A bad install can cause leaks or, worse, contaminate your water supply. Sometimes the countertop water distiller is a simpler point-of-use alternative for drinking water only.
